Carline has developed a peculiar problem with her eyes. She now has a
tendency to
close her eyes and keep them shut tightly to the extent that she sort of
grimaces with her face.
This is especially true for her left eye on her bad side. She has also
developed an infection
in her eyes for which I got "Polytrim" yesterday. But she had the tendency
to close her eyes even before
she had the infection. I asked her if light is bothering her, she says it
is not. On the other hand
she seems to be more sensitive and asks for sunglasses when we are
outside.
1. Has anybody had trouble with pulling the eyes shut?
2. Has anybody had problems with excessive light sensitivity, photophobia
(due to the meds perhaps)?
3. Do people with PD want to shut out the world?
Comments appreciated.
